Issue Date: | Mar-2009 | Publisher: | The American Physical Society | Abstract: | We study the flavor-changing quark-graviton vertex that is induced atthe one-loop level when gravitational interactions are coupled to thestandard model. Because of the conservation of the energy-momentumtensor the corresponding form factors turn out to be finite and gaugeinvariant. Analytical expressions of the form factors are provided atleading order in the external masses. We show that flavor-changinginteractions in gravity are local if the graviton is strictly masslesswhile if the graviton has a small mass long-range interactions inducinga flavor-changing contribution in the Newton potential appear.Flavor-changing processes with massive spin-2 particles are alsobriefly discussed. These results can be generalized to the case of thelepton-graviton coupling. | URI: | http://hdl.handle.net/2307/332 | ISSN: | 1550-7998 | DOI: | 10.1103/PhysRevD.79.053004 |
